Principes fondamentaux de l'accessibilité web
L'importance cruciale de l'accessibilité numérique
Le digital n'est plus une simple option, c'est une extension de notre existence. L'accessibilité web vise à garantir que les services et les contenus soient accessibles à tous, y compris les personnes handicapées. D'après le World Wide Web Consortium (W3C), l'accessibilité est essentielle pour les développeurs et les organisations souhaitant atteindre une audience plus vaste et respecter les normes légales. Des statistiques récentes révèlent que plus de 25% des internautes pourraient bénéficier d'un web plus accessible. Les principes de l'accessibilité numérique s'appuient sur quatre piliers : perceptibilité, utilisabilité, compréhensibilité, et robustesse.
Les quatre piliers de l'accessibilité
- Perceptibilité : L'information doit être présentée de manière à être perçue par tous. Il est essentiel de prévoir des alternatives textuelles pour tout contenu non textuel.
- Utilisabilité : Les composants des sites web et les navigateurs doivent être exploitables. Par exemple, assurer la navigation au clavier pour les personnes incapables d'utiliser une souris.
- Compréhensibilité : L'information et la gestion des interfaces utilisateurs doivent être compréhensibles, ce qui implique une clarté dans le langage et la présentation.
- Robustesse : Le contenu doit être suffisamment robuste pour être interprété de manière fiable par une vaste gamme de technologies d'assistance.
Normes et directives à suivre
Les normes d'accessibilité sont formalisées par les Règles pour l'accessibilité des contenus Web (WCAG). Les WCAG 2.1 actuelles forment un cadre rigoureux pour optimiser l'accessibilité web. Ces normes sont le fruit de consensus internationaux et représentent les meilleures pratiques à travers le globe. Des études montrent que les sites respectant les WCAG connaissent une amélioration de leur audience et de l'expérience utilisateur globale. De plus, elles constituent souvent un critère de référencement naturel SEO, augmentant la visibilité des sites sur les moteurs de recherche.
Outils et techniques pour évaluer l'accessibilité
Outils d'analyse de l'accessibilité en ligne
Pour assurer que votre site web soit accessible à tous, il est crucial de se munir d'outils d'évaluation spécialisés. Des extensions de navigateur telles que WAVE ou axe fournissent des analyses instantanées de l'accessibilité d'une page web. Selon le WebAIM Million, une étude annuelle de l'accessibilité, moins de 1 % des sites web répondent aux critères d'accessibilité de base. L'utilisation de ces outils est donc essentielle pour identifier et corriger les problèmes d'accessibilité.
Intégration des tests automatisés dans le développement
Intégrer des tests automatisés dans les cycles de développement peut considérablement faciliter le maintien de l'accessibilité. Des logiciels tels que Pa11y ou Google Lighthouse permettent d'effectuer des contrôles réguliers et fournissent des statistiques et des rapports détaillés. Rappelez-vous que l'automatisation ne remplace pas l'évaluation manuelle mais permet d'identifier rapidement les problèmes les plus évidents.
L'expertise humaine pour compléter l'évaluation
Tout en utilisant les outils pour analyser l'accessibilité, n'oubliez pas l'importance de l'expertise humaine. Les évaluations manuelles par des professionnels formés peuvent déceler des subtilités que les outils automatiques ne saisissent pas. Selon le Global Web Index, 90% des utilisateurs d'Internet veulent des sites accessibles, ce qui souligne l'importance d'une approche humaine dans l'évaluation de l'accessibilité.
Les checklists d'accessibilité pour maintenir les normes
Les checklists d'accessibilité, basées sur les directives WCAG, sont des ressources précieuses pour les développeurs et les concepteurs web. Elles détaillent les critères à respecter pour garantir l'accessibilité. Ces listes de contrôle peuvent servir de référence rapide et efficace tout au long du processus de conception et de développement. Par exemple, la WCAG Checklist de The A11Y Project est un exemple notable.
Utilisez des simulations pour comprendre les défis de l'accessibilité
Les simulations permettent aux concepteurs de comprendre les défis rencontrés par les utilisateurs en situation de handicap. Des outils comme NoCoffee et d'autres peuvent simuler des expériences utilisateur spécifiques, telles que la vision floue ou daltonienne, offrant ainsi une perspective riche et empathique. S'approprier des statistiques comme celles rapportées par le World Health Organization, qui affirme que 285 millions de personnes sont atteintes de déficience visuelle, met en lumière pourquoi ces pratiques sont fondamentales.
Formations et ressources pour une expertise en accessibilité
Se former et utiliser les ressources disponibles est un pilier dans le domaine de l'accessibilité web. Des organisations telles que la Web Accessibility Initiative (WAI) et des cours en ligne offrent des formations pour élever la compétence des équipes de développement. Les connaissances acquises permettent de mettre en avant une accessibilité proactive et réfléchie qui bénéficie à tous les utilisateurs du web.
Études de cas: Erreurs courantes et solutions
Analyse d'une erreur d'accessibilité: Le manque de contraste
L'un des défis les plus fréquemment rencontrés dans la création de sites inclusifs réside dans l'assurance d'un contraste suffisant entre le texte et son arrière-plan. Selon le Web Content Accessibility Guidelines (WCAG), le ratio de contraste minimal pour le texte standard est de 4.5:1. Une étude de WebAIM montre que 21.6% des pages web ne répondent pas à ce critère de base. Pour pallier à cela, utilisons des outils comme Color Contrast Analyzer qui permet de vérifier rapidement si les combinaisons de couleurs sont conformes aux standards.
Solution pratique: Des images non accessibles
Les images portent souvent un message essentiel pour la compréhension du contenu. Or, une enquête de W3C indique qu'un grand nombre d'éléments visuels ne sont pas correctement décrits pour les lecteurs d'écran. La solution peut être illustrée par l'ajout systématique d'attributs alt pertinents pour toutes les images. Ceux-ci doivent décrire précisément le contenu ou la fonction de l'image, comme dans l'exemple d'une boutique en ligne qui ajoute pour chaque produit une description claire permettant l'imagination du produit par un utilisateur malvoyant.
Non-conformité de la navigation au clavier: Exemples et rectifications
La navigation au clavier est vitale pour les utilisateurs ayant des limitations motrices. Un rapport révèle que 10% des sites testés présentaient des problèmes importants de navigation au clavier. Pour résoudre ce problème, il est important de faire un audit de la fonctionnalité des tabulations et des raccourcis clavier, et de s'assurer que toutes les actions sur le site peuvent être réalisées sans l'utilisation d'une souris. Le cas d'un site de e-commerce qui a restructuré son menu pour être pleinement navigable au clavier est un exemple éloquent de solution bien exécutée.
Amélioration de l'accessibilité en utilisant ARIA
ARIA (Accessible Rich Internet Applications) définit un ensemble de rôles et propriétés spécifiques pour améliorer l'accessibilité des applications web complexes. Toutefois, son utilisation incorrecte peut avoir l'effet inverse. Un cas d'emploi judicieux d'ARIA serait l'ajout de rôles sur des éléments non traditionnellement interactifs pour les rendre accessibles aux technologies d'assistance. Par exemple, l'indentification d'une liste de liens en tant que 'navigation' peut aider les technologies d'assistance à les reconnaître comme tels. ARIA est puissant, mais doit être utilisé avec discernement, comme le suggère une recommandation de MDN Web Docs.
Mise en practice: Améliorer l'accessibilité étape par étape
Comprendre le WCAG pour l'amélioration de l'accessibilité
L'initiative pour l'accessibilité du Web (WAI) fournit des Règles pour l'accessibilité des contenus Web (WCAG) essentielles. Intégrer en profondeur ces directives améliore considérablement l'accessibilité. Par exemple, selon W3C, la mise en œuvre des WCAG 2.1 permet de rendre les contenus web plus accessibles pour les personnes handicapées. Adoptez une démarche analytique en identifiant spécifiquement les critères de succès pertinents pour votre site.
Évaluation et outils pour un site inclusif
- Audit d'accessibilité: Utilisez des outils comme AXE ou Lighthouse pour évaluer les failles.
- Tests utilisateurs: Recueillez des retours d'utilisateurs présentant différents handicaps.
Les statistiques montrent l'importance de ces évaluations – l'engagement utilisateur peut augmenter jusqu'à 50% quand un site est accessible (source: WebAIM Million).
Développement et maintien de l'accessibilité
Pensez à une intégration continue de l'accessibilité dans votre processus de développement web. Les changements réguliers du contenu et des fonctionnalités nécessitent une attention constante. En effet, selon Google Developers, négliger l'accessibilité pendant les mises à jour peut entraîner des régressions majeures.
Formation et sensibilisation de l'équipe
Constituez une culture d'entreprise axée sur l'accessibilité. Des sessions de formation favorisent l'expertise collective – une étude de Forrester révèle que les entreprises formant leurs employés à l'accessibilité voient une amélioration jusqu’à 30% de la satisfaction client.
Utiliser des modèles de conception accessibles
Adoptez des templates de design ayant l'accessibilité comme fondement. Selon Interaction Design Foundation, l'utilisation de composants réutilisables et testés pour l'accessibilité accélère le développement et assure la conformité.